Transaction e5323f3ef51a0330251a2427a8e3e686c5fbe7175ba2abd47830bcae40fcb92e
1 Input
1 Outputs
- e5323f3ef51a0330251a2427a8e3e686c5fbe7175ba2abd47830bcae40fcb92e:0
value 1173330
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u